Barn roof replacement services involve the removal of an existing barn roof and the installation of a new roofing system.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of structure, removing damaged or outdated materials, and then installing new roofing materials that provide improved durability and protection. The service aims to ensure the structural integrity of the barn, prevent leaks, and extend the lifespan of the building by replacing worn or compromised roofing components.
This service helps address common problems such as leaks, water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ration caused by aging, weather exposure, or storm damage. A compromised roof can lead to further issues inside the barn, including damage to stored equipment, feed, or livestock areas. Replacing the roof can also improve energy efficiency by reducing drafts and heat loss, which is particularly important for maintaining proper conditions within agricultural or storage structures.
Barn roof replacement services are typically sought for various types of properties, including agricultural barns, storage facilities, horse stables, and other large outbuildings. These structures often face the challenge of prolonged exposure to the elements, making regular maintenance or timely replacement necessary to preserve their utility and safety.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for barn roof replacements typ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of material chosen, such as metal or asphalt shingles. For a standard barn, material expenses can vary based on size and quality.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for barn roof replacement gener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with total project costs influenced by the roof’s size and complexity. Larger or more intricate roofs may incur higher labor charges. Contact local contractors for accurate project estimates.
Project Scope Factors - The overall cost can fluctuate based on the scope of work, including the removal of existing roofing, repairs to the underlying structure, and additional features. These factors can add several hundred to thousands of dollars to the total cost. Local service providers can assess specific project requirements.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, disposal fees, or special weatherproofing can impact the final cost, typically adding 10-20% to the base project price. These costs vary depending on local regulations and project details. Pros can clarify potential additional charges during consultation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my barn roof needs replacement? Signs such as visible damage, leaks, sagging, or missing shingles indicate it may be time to consider a roof replacement. A local roofing professional can assess the condition of the roof to determine if replacement is necessary.
What types of roofing materials are available for barn roof replacement? Common options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ood shakes, and rubber roofing. A local contractor can help choose the best material based on durability and style preferences.
How long does a barn ro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size of the barn and the complexity of the project. Generally, replacement can take from a few days to a week with the assistance of local roofing specialists.
Are there any permits required for barn roof replacement? Permit requirements depend on local regulations. Consulting with a local contractor can ensure compliance with any necessary permits or approvals.
